Graph 3x+y=-10 -x+3y=0
nikdorinn [45]

The slope-intercept form of an equation of a line:

y=mx+b

m - slope

b - y-intercept

We have the equations in the standard form. Convert to the slope-intercept form:

3x+y=-10            <em>subtract 3x from both sides</em>

y=-3x-10

-x+3y=0             <em>add x to both sides</em>

3y=x             <em>divide both sides by 3</em>

y=\dfrac{1}{3}x

-----------------------------------------------------

We need only two points to plot a graph of each function.

y=-3x-10

for x = 0 and for x = -3:

y=-3(0)-10=0-10=-10\to(0,\ -10)\\\\y=-3(-3)-10=9-10=-1\to(-3,\ -1)

y=\dfrac{1}{3}x

for x = 0 and for x = -3:

y=\dfrac{1}{3}(0)=0\to(0,\ 0)\\\\y=\dfrac{1}{3}(-3)=-1\to(-3,\ -1)
